Vorheriges Thema anzeigen :: Nächstes Thema anzeigen |
Autor |
Nachricht |
Devilkevin aka Kerstin
Anmeldungsdatum: 11.11.2004 Beiträge: 2532 Wohnort: nähe Mannheim
|
Verfasst am: 13.02.2006, 22:58 Titel: Dateiübertragung über Internet! |
|
|
Hi, ich suche eine Lib die Funktionen zur Dateiübertragung über Internet bietet. Eine Zahl oder einen String zu "übertragen" wäre schon ein Anfang
Welche Libs gibts da, und welche würdet ihr nutzen? Ich dachte an die SDL Lib, gibt leider keine hilfreiche deutsche Dokumentation (zumindest nicht für die Netzwerkbefehle der SDL).
Oder geht das irgendwie mit WinAPI zugriffen? Bin über jeden Code Schnippsel dankbar _________________ www.piratenpartei.de |
|
Nach oben |
|
|
Sebastian Administrator
Anmeldungsdatum: 10.09.2004 Beiträge: 5969 Wohnort: Deutschland
|
|
Nach oben |
|
|
MisterD
Anmeldungsdatum: 10.09.2004 Beiträge: 3071 Wohnort: bei Darmstadt
|
Verfasst am: 13.02.2006, 23:11 Titel: |
|
|
probier doch mal winsock, gutes tut auf c-worker.ch. _________________ "It is practically impossible to teach good programming to students that have had a prior exposure to BASIC: as potential programmers they are mentally mutilated beyond hope of regeneration."
Edsger W. Dijkstra |
|
Nach oben |
|
|
Devilkevin aka Kerstin
Anmeldungsdatum: 11.11.2004 Beiträge: 2532 Wohnort: nähe Mannheim
|
Verfasst am: 13.02.2006, 23:16 Titel: |
|
|
Sebastian hat Folgendes geschrieben: | Wie übertragen? Etwas mit HTTP downloaden? Mit FTP upladen oder downloaden? Eigenes Protokoll? |
Nein, HTTP und FTP sind kein Problem
Ich möchte direkt von "Computer zu Computer" eine Datei, oder für den Anfang tuts auch eine Zahl/String übertragen/senden. Quasi das jemand eine Zahl eingibt die bei dem anderen auf dem Bildschirm erscheint. Später soll das ganze mit Datein funktionieren. _________________ www.piratenpartei.de |
|
Nach oben |
|
|
Michael712 aka anfänger, programmierer
Anmeldungsdatum: 26.03.2005 Beiträge: 1593
|
Verfasst am: 14.02.2006, 15:38 Titel: |
|
|
Hallo.
Wenn du das mit Winsock machen möchtest, dann kann ich dir was "fertiges" anbieten.
*klick*
Kannst ja mal gucken, ob du das gebrauchen kannst. Da ist ein Beispielprogramm mit einem sehr einfachem Chat Server und Client.
Einmal in der variante wo man Strings sendet, einmal wo man integer variablen sendet. Wie gesagt, gucks dir an und nimm das, was du brauchst. Für mich hat das bis jetzt immer gereicht.
Michael _________________
Code: | #include "signatur.bi" |
|
|
Nach oben |
|
|
Progger_X Mr. Lagg
Anmeldungsdatum: 24.11.2004 Beiträge: 784 Wohnort: Leipzig
|
Verfasst am: 28.02.2006, 17:43 Titel: |
|
|
Also ich würd dir eindeutig SDL_Net empfehlen. Es ist einfach und es ist alles dabei, was man braucht. Zusätzlich kannst du, falls du irgendwie doch mal nen vernünftigen Locate Befehl brauchst, gleich SDL für die Graphik verwenden.
Einen Beispielcode gabs im Internationalen Forum, wenn du da nix findest, frag mich einfach mal, ich hab da genügend zeugs da. |
|
Nach oben |
|
|
Devilkevin aka Kerstin
Anmeldungsdatum: 11.11.2004 Beiträge: 2532 Wohnort: nähe Mannheim
|
Verfasst am: 16.04.2006, 10:12 Titel: |
|
|
Hi nochmal, also ich hab mich gestern Nacht mit twei Testperson durch SDL, Winsock, FTP und Co. gequält ... nochmal danke an Progger X und programmierer für die Beispiele und Tutorials
Ich werd wohl die Winsock für mein neues Projekt nehmen, ist einfacher aufgebaut als SDL und es gibt ne schöne Dokumentation auf MSDN _________________ www.piratenpartei.de |
|
Nach oben |
|
|
MisterD
Anmeldungsdatum: 10.09.2004 Beiträge: 3071 Wohnort: bei Darmstadt
|
Verfasst am: 16.04.2006, 13:06 Titel: |
|
|
winsock is einfacher aufgebaut als sdl? oO SDL is so ziemlich am einfachsten zu benutzen aber du bist halt eingeschränkter als mit winsock, sachen wie select gibts nicht. aber einfacher ist garantiert sdl... _________________ "It is practically impossible to teach good programming to students that have had a prior exposure to BASIC: as potential programmers they are mentally mutilated beyond hope of regeneration."
Edsger W. Dijkstra |
|
Nach oben |
|
|
|